OPINION
PER CURIAM:
John Douglas Pinchback appeals from the district court's dismissal without
prejudice, pursuant to 28 U.S.C. 1915(d) (1988), of his claim for relief under
42 U.S.C. 1983 (1988). After a review of the record, we conclude that the
appeal is without merit and affirm.
